The Libra spirit animal is the raven, a bird of striking intelligence and social grace whose love of harmony, partnership, and beauty mirrors the seventh sign of the zodiac. Libra is the cardinal air sign, ruled by Venus and devoted to balance, fairness, and connection, and the raven is the creature that builds bonds, weighs situations with uncanny cleverness, and is drawn to elegance in everything it does.
This guide explains why the raven fits Libra so well, which other animals carry Libra energy, and what the pairing reveals about people born under the scales.
Why the Raven Is the Libra Spirit Animal
Libra is ruled by Venus and carried on the element of air, a combination that produces diplomacy, aesthetic sense, and a deep need for partnership. The raven lives the same way:
- Social intelligence. Ravens form complex bonds and remember faces. Libra, too, is wired for relationship and reads social dynamics with ease.
- Balance and judgement. The raven weighs options with famous cleverness. Libra weighs every side before deciding, seeking what is fair.
- Pairing. Ravens often mate for life and move in pairs. Libra is the zodiac's partner, most itself in connection with another.
- Attraction to beauty. Ravens are drawn to elegant, striking objects. Venus-ruled Libra has the same eye for harmony and beauty.
- Communication. Ravens are vocal and expressive. Libra is the diplomat, fluent in the language that keeps people in accord.
Libra Personality and Its Animal Energy
The raven captures the Libra core: a person who values harmony, builds bonds with grace, and brings intelligence and fairness to every relationship. Raven energy is social cleverness joined to a love of beauty, which is exactly the diplomatic charm Libra is known for.
The dove adds Libra's longing for peace and gentle accord. Where the raven supplies cleverness, the dove supplies the instinct for reconciliation, the wish to soothe conflict and restore calm that makes Libra such a natural peacemaker.
The swan rounds out the picture with elegance and devotion. Swan energy is grace, beauty, and lifelong partnership. Libra often works the same way: refined, relationship-centred, and happiest when life has poise and a partner to share it with.
The Libra Spirit Animal's Shadow Side
The raven's love of balance becomes paralysis when every side must be weighed. Libra under stress can stall on decisions, avoid conflict until resentment builds, and lose its own position trying to keep everyone happy. The same desire for harmony can tip into people-pleasing, a self that bends so far toward others it disappears.
Working consciously with Libra energy means keeping the raven's fairness while learning that some imbalance is the price of choosing, and a real self.
